Evolution of Robotic Vacuum Cleaners
The idea of a robot that might clean up floorings dates back to the early 2000s, but it was the launch of iRobot's Roomba in 2002 that genuinely set the phase for the modern-day robotic vacuum. Initially, these devices were easy, utilizing random navigation patterns to cover floors. However, for many years, developments in technology have actually led to more sophisticated designs geared up with innovative sensors, mapping abilities, and expert system (AI).
Today, robotic vacuum are not just more effective however likewise more intelligent. They can navigate complex floor strategies, prevent challenges, and even connect to smart home systems, enabling remote control and scheduling. This development has actually made them a useful and dependable alternative for property owners wanting to improve their cleaning regimens.
Secret Features of Robotic Vacuum Cleaners
Mapping and Navigation
Laser or Camera Navigation: Modern robotic vacuum cleaners use lidar (light detection and ranging) or visual video cameras to produce comprehensive maps of your home. This enables them to browse effectively, avoid obstacles, and tidy in a systematic pattern.Virtual Boundaries: Many designs include virtual boundary features, which allow users to set no-go zones using infrared beacons or in-app settings, making sure that the robot stays within designated areas.
Suction Power and Brush Systems
High Suction Power: Despite their compact size, robotic vacuums are created to get a range of debris, from big particles to fine dust. Some models provide suction power similar to that of conventional vacuums.Brush Systems: Most robotic vacuums are geared up with side brushes and main brushes. Side brushes assist to sweep debris from corners and edges, while the main brush collects the debris and directs it into the dustbin.
Battery Life and Charging
Long Battery Life: Robotic vacuums have batteries that can last for several hours, depending on the model. Some high-end designs can clean for as much as 3 hours on a single charge.Automatic Recharging: When the battery is low, the Robot Robotic Vacuum Cleaners automatically returns to its charging dock to recharge. As soon as fully charged, it resumes cleaning where it left off.
Smart Home Integration
Voice Control: Many robotic vacuums work with smart home assistants like Amazon Alexa, Google Assistant, and Apple Siri, allowing users to control the device with voice commands.App Control: Most designs come with a mobile app that allows users to schedule cleansings, monitor performance, and get notices.
Upkeep and Cleaning
Self-Emptying: Some advanced models come with self-emptying capabilities, which suggests the robot can dock and clear its dustbin into a bigger container, lowering the need for manual cleaning.Filter and Brush Maintenance: Regular upkeep is still needed to guarantee ideal performance. Q1: How typically should I clean my robotic vacuum?
A1: It is recommended to clean up the filters and brushes of your robotic vacuum after every couple of cleanings to make sure optimal efficiency. The dustbin needs to be emptied after each use, and the charging dock must be cleaned up regularly to keep it totally free from dust and particles.
Q2: Do robotic vacuums work well on stairs?
A2: Most robotic vacuums are not designed to tidy stairs. They are equipped with cliff sensing units that avoid them from falling off edges, so they will prevent stairs. If you require to tidy stairs, a standard vacuum or a portable gadget would be preferable.
Q3: Can robotic vacuums tidy under furniture?
A3: Yes, many robotic vacuums are created to be slim and can quickly fit under furnishings to clean hard-to-reach areas. Nevertheless, if you have very low furnishings, you might need to raise it periodically to enable the robot to clean below.
Q4: Are robotic vacuums great for pet hair?
A4: Many robotic vacuums are specifically created to deal with pet hair with specialized brush systems and high suction power. If you have family pets, search for models with strong pet hair cleaning abilities to ensure that your floors stay tidy and devoid of fur.
Q5: Can I manage my robotic vacuum from another location?
A5: Yes, most modern-day robotic vacuums can be controlled from another location utilizing a mobile app or smart home assistant. This enables you to start, stop, and schedule cleanings from anywhere, making it a practical feature for busy house owners.
